Miles Community College is located in Miles City, MT.

In the most recent year for which we have data, 7 plant sciences degrees were granted at Miles Community College.

Online & Distance Learning at Miles Community College

Distance learning is available at Miles Community College. Among 710 students, 319 (45%) studied exclusively online and 177 (25%) took at least some classes online.
